‘I Edit as I Write, Unfortunately.’ Sa’eed Husaini’s First Draft.

Politics scholar and author of ‘How to Write about Boko Haram’, Sa’eed Husaini, thinks it’s important to know how to write a ‘shit draft’. ‘Finish the full writing task first,’ he says, ‘no matter how unpleasant the initial output may seem, and then return to tidy up the mess.’ Our questions are italicized.  What books or kinds of books did you read growing up?
